Ingredients
Carrot ( 100g ) | Rice ( 400g ) |
Pork ribs ( 400g ) | Potato ( 150g ) |
Dark soy sauce ( Moderate amount ) | Cooking wine (appropriate amount) |
| Oil ( Adequate amount ) | Light soy sauce ( Appropriate amount ) |
Spare rib sauce ( Appropriate amount ) | Oyster sauce (appropriate amount) |
Salt (appropriate amount) |
How to make spareribs clay pot rice

1. Wash the spareribs and marinate them with cooking wine, salt, light soy sauce and sparerib sauce for 2 hours.

2.Cut carrots and potatoes into strips

3. Put a little oil in the pot, fry the ribs on both sides, add boiling water, a little dark soy sauce, bring to a boil and then simmer on low heat 20 minutes.

4.Add potatoes and carrots and stir-fry over high heat to reduce the juice and set aside.

5.Put some oil at the bottom of the casserole.

6. Soak the rice for 30 minutes in advance, add the rice, and mix it with water at a ratio of 1:1 Cook in proportion.After boiling, cover with high heat and medium to low heat.

7. When the rice is medium cooked, pour some oil around the edge of the pot.

8. Put the ribs, potatoes and carrots and continue to simmer for 20 minutes, then turn off the heat and simmer.10 minutes.

9. Blanch the vegetables, remove them, add light soy sauce, oyster sauce, water and sesame oil to make a juice

10.When the pot is out, put the vegetables, pour in the sauce and stir
